ANM full form is Auxiliary Nursing Midwifery. ANM Nursing is a 2 year Diploma course. It primarily deals with the health care sector. The course provides knowledge about setting up operation theatre, taking care of various equipment, maintaining records, and also administering timely medication to patients. There are a total of 1936 colleges for these courses, out of which 1615 are private, and 275 are governmental institutions. The total number of seats for this course in India is 1,00,930. The required eligibility criteria for pursuing ANM courses is that candidates have to score a minimum of 50% aggregate marks in their 10+2 exams.
